FREMONT, Calif. — Purfresh has announced a new milestone: The company’s water purification systems are used around the globe to treat an estimated 25 billion gallons of water on an annual basis, or 68.5 million gallons per day.
"More important than the number of gallons we've treated, this 25-billion (gallon) milestone reflects our long-standing commitment to the water industry, including bottled water, pharmaceutical and personal care companies," said David Cope, president and CEO of Purfresh.
Purfresh’s ozone solutions for water purification and disinfection provide bottlers with integrated systems to efficiently treat water used in their operations. The company has installed aqueous systems in more than 20 countries, and treated approximately 145 trillion gallons of water.
Purfresh counts among its customers Neutrogena, Auvil Fruit Company, Broetje/First Fruit of Washington, PepsiCo, Arrowhead, Coca-Cola and Proctor & Gamble.
